Transaction 39940aa42fce2871274948e21801d6c10514392670bb343e682c02627ca09e9e

1 Input
2 Outputs
  • 39940aa42fce2871274948e21801d6c10514392670bb343e682c02627ca09e9e:0
  • value  7149764
    address  3GdRqtEhG2SrFUeB9jSRgK9uY9gZDJaMr3
  • 39940aa42fce2871274948e21801d6c10514392670bb343e682c02627ca09e9e:1
  • value  9937844
    address  38fDd8WgAaZDAEHFKkmGurV4Lopj7wbuR9